Here's the best way to create Print Email Signature Allocation Agreement with pdfFiller:
Select any readily available option to add a PDF file for signing.
Utilize the toolbar at the top of the interface and choose the Sign option.
You can mouse-draw your signature, type it or upload a photo of it - our tool will digitize it automatically. Once your signature is set up, click Save and sign.
Click on the form place where you want to put an Print Email Signature Allocation Agreement. You can move the newly generated signature anywhere on the page you want or change its settings. Click OK to save the adjustments.
As soon as your form is all set, click on the DONE button in the top right corner.
Once you're done with certifying your paperwork, you will be redirected to the Dashboard.
Utilize the Dashboard settings to download the executed form, send it for further review, or print it out.
